Welcome to Clark Retirement Community

Thanks to a generous act of philanthropy in 1906, Clark Retirement Community was created as a haven for retired Methodist ministers. Perhaps that´s the origin of the discernable Clark spirit – a belief that genuine relationships are forged when people live and work together in an environment of compassion.

Clark is a not-for-profit, continuing care retirement community, offering a full complement of services and residential options from independent living and assisted living to skilled nursing. If you should ever need additional care, you can remain at Clark.

Most people come to Clark seeking ways to remain active and engaged, wanting to be a vital part of a genuine community. They aren’t disappointed. Opportunities for fun and friendship are outlined in Life at Clark.

While our hallmark is service excellence and enduring relationships, one more thing makes us distinctive. The Clark Commitment. When you become a long-term resident, we pledge to provide services for the rest of your life. If longevity or care needs deplete your resources, you continue to receive the same excellent care no matter where you are living at Clark.
